Van Persie to make first league start since leaving Man Utd

Fenerbahçe striker Robin van Persie is expected to make his first start for his new side since leaving Manchester United last month.

Van Persie scored his first goal for the Istanbul giants with his first shot for Fenerbahçe in the 1-0 victory over Atromitos in the Europa League play-off stages last Thursday.

The Yellow Canaries have not lost against Rizespor in the league for the last six games.

Fenerbahçe do not have recent fond memories of Rize as it was where the team bus was attacked by gunmen on the way back to Istanbul after last seasons game.

The assailants involved in the attack have yet to be caught and a heavy security presence is expected at the game and afterwards.
